H3: The Basics of AC Maintenance (No, It’s Not Just Changing Filters)
Yes, changing your filter matters. But there’s more to it. Think of your AC like a marathon runner—it needs hydration (refrigerant), clean shoes (coils), and regular checkups (professional maintenance).
- Clean Those Coils: Dirt and debris clogging your outdoor unit? That’s like asking LeBron to play in snow boots. Not ideal.
- Check the Refrigerant: Low levels = poor cooling. If your system’s gasping for Freon, it’s time for a pro.
- Clear the Area: Keep plants, lawn chairs, and rogue soccer balls at least 2 feet away from the outdoor unit.

Signs Your AC Is Crying for Help (And What to Do)
Ever heard your AC make a noise that sounds like a dying robot? Or noticed it’s blowing warm air like a hair dryer? These aren’t “quirks”—they’re red flags.
H3: “Is This Normal?” Spoiler: Probably Not
- Strange Noises: Grinding, squealing, or banging = call for HVAC repair ASAP.
- Weak Airflow: Could be a duct issue, a failing motor, or a clogged filter. (Hint: Start with the filter.)
- Sky-High Bills: If your energy costs spike like Cedar Point’s Top Thrill Dragster, your system’s efficiency is tanking.
H3: DIY Fixes vs. “Call the Pros” Moments
- DIY: Changing filters, cleaning vents, resetting the thermostat.
- Call Us: Electrical issues, refrigerant leaks, or anything involving tools sharper than a butter knife.

H3: Sizing Matters (No, Really)
Bigger isn’t better. An oversized unit will short-cycle, wasting energy and wearing out faster. Too small? It’ll run nonstop and still leave you sticky.

The Ultimate AC Maintenance Checklist
Want to avoid 90% of AC problems? Follow this simple guide.
| Task | How Often | Why It Matters |
|---|---|---|
| Replace air filter | Every 1–3 months | Improves airflow, reduces strain on system |
| Clean outdoor unit | Monthly in summer | Prevents debris buildup, boosts efficiency |
| Schedule professional tune-up | Annually | Catches small issues before they’re costly |
| Check thermostat settings | Seasonally | Ensures system isn’t overworking |
4 Burning Questions (Answered Without the Jargon)
1. “How often should I schedule AC maintenance?”
At least once a year, ideally before summer hits. Think of it like a physical for your AC—prevents surprises.
2. “Can I just ignore a small refrigerant leak?”
Nope. Refrigerant doesn’t “wear out”—if levels are low, you’ve got a leak. And inhaling that stuff? Not a vibe.
3. “My system’s 15 years old. Should I replace it?”
IMO, yes. Older units are less efficient and prone to breakdowns. Plus, newer models could cut your energy bills by up to 30%.
4. “What’s that smell when I turn on the AC?”
If it’s musty, you’ve got mold. If it’s burning, turn it off and call us immediately. Your AC shouldn’t smell like a campfire.
